The Land Value Tax Plan would cut property taxes by 17% while more than doubling the tax rate on land, including abandoned buildings and vacant lots.
The proposal will head to the state legislature for approval and voters could see the tax plan on the Detroit ballot next February. If approved, the program would be phased in over three years starting in 2025.
